History of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ret

The history of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ret dates back to 1620, when the Mongeard family settled in Vosne-Romanée, at the heart of the Burgundy wine region. For more than eight generations, this family expertise was patiently passed down, enriched and perfected. It was not until 1945 that the estate officially took its current name, when Eugène Mongeard and his wife Edmée Mugneret united their estates and expertise to create a domaine whose reputation has continued to grow ever since.

Vincent Mongeard, the current owner, perpetuates this tradition with passion and dedication, overseeing every stage of production, from the vineyard to the cellar. Under his leadership, the estate today extends over 30 hectares, with 35 appellations covering some of the most prestigious terroirs in Burgundy, including Vosne-Romanée, Nuits-Saint-Georges, Echezeaux, and Richebourg.

The estate has built a solid reputation, notably for its consistency year after year. Far from resting on its laurels in "great vintages", the Mongeard family places its trust in exemplary regularity. The estate makes a point of producing accessible wines, meeting a growing demand for crus that can be enjoyed young, while retaining excellent ageing potential for those who wish to cellar them.

Terroirs and Vines of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ret

Terroir is the very essence of the wines of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ret. Located between the majestic Château du Clos de Vougeot and the town of Nuits-Saint-Georges, in Vosne-Romanée, the estate benefits from a strategic position on exceptional terroirs. The parcels, planted on mid-slope sites, enjoy an ideal south-east orientation, providing the vines with optimal sunlight for slow and regular ripening of the grapes. The soils are predominantly clay-limestone, a terroir typical of the Côte de Nuits, renowned for producing wines that are both refined and complex.

The 30 hectares of vines, with an average age of 40 years, are carefully cultivated according to the principles of integrated pest management. The estate purchases no grapes and dedicates itself entirely to the production of its own parcels. Pinot Noir reigns supreme for the red wines, bringing finesse and depth, while Chardonnay and Aligoté are used for the white wines, offering freshness and minerality.

The meticulous care of the vines includes rigorous pruning, green harvesting to regulate yields and constant attention to the quality of the grapes. Every step is carried out by hand, ensuring that only the finest fruit is harvested for the production of exceptional wines.

Winemaking at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ret

At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ret, winemaking is a precisely mastered art. Each cuvée is vinified with care, according to the characteristics of the appellation and the vintage. Fermentation takes place in temperature-controlled vats, ensuring strict temperature control for optimal extraction of aromas and tannins. Cold maceration, which often precedes fermentation, gently extracts phenolic compounds, guaranteeing a beautiful colour and aromatic complexity.

Alcoholic fermentation lasts on average 12 to 15 days, depending on the vintage. Once this stage is complete, a delicate pressing is carried out using a pneumatic press, which preserves the wine's finesse by avoiding overly intense extraction of tannins. The wines are then moved to the cellar by gravity and aged in oak barrels for 18 to 22 months, depending on the cuvée.

The barrels, crafted from oak sourced from the Allier and Nièvre forests, bring roundness and subtlety to the wine during ageing. Some of the barrels used are new, while the percentage of new wood varies according to the vintage and the appellation to avoid an over-concentration of woody aromas. Ageing is followed by bottling without filtration, in order to preserve the wine's authenticity and aromatic richness. The estate thus guarantees consistent and irreproachable quality for every vintage.

The cuvées of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ret

Domaine Mongeard-Mugneret offers a rich and varied range of cuvées, covering a great diversity of terroirs and prestigious appellations. The estate produces in particular:

Grand Cru

Echezeaux Grand Cru "Vieille Vigne" ; Grands Echezeaux Grand Cru ; Clos de Vougeot Grand Cru ; Richebourg Grand Cru

Premier Cru

Vosne-Romanée 1er Cru "En Orveaux" ; Vosne-Romanée 1er Cru "Les Petits Monts" ; Vosne-Romanée 1er Cru "Les Suchots" ; Nuits-Saint-Georges 1er Cru "Aux Boudots" ; Vougeot 1er Cru "Les Cras" ; Vougeot 1er Cru "Les Petits Vougeots" ; Beaune 1er Cru "Les Avaux" ; Pernand-Vergelesses 1er Cru "Les Vergelesses" ; Savigny-les-Beaune 1er Cru "Les Narbantons"

Village

Marsannay "Clos du Roy" ; Fixin "Vieille Vigne"; Chambolle-Musigny ; Gevrey-Chambertin ; Vosne-Romanée "Les Maizières Hautes" ; Nuits-Saint-Georges "Les Plateaux"

Regional

Crémant de Bourgogne "Chloé" ; Bourgogne Aligoté ; Bourgogne Chardonnay ; Bourgogne Hautes-Côtes de Nuits Blanc "Le Prieuré" ; Bourgogne Hautes-Côtes de Nuits Rouge "La Croix" ; Bourgogne Hautes-Côtes de Nuits Rouge "Les Dames Huguettes" ; Bourgogne Pinot Noir "Cuvée Sapidus" ; Coteaux Bourguignons "La Superbe" ; Bourgogne Rosé "Cuvée Maxence"

Each cuvée reflects the terroir from which it originates, offering wines that are both powerful and delicate, with a rich aromatic palette and exceptional ageing potential.
